How Solar Panels Generate Electricity



Solar panels harness the sunlight's energy by converting sunshine right into electricity via a procedure known as the photovoltaic effect. When sunlight strikes the photovoltaic panels, the photons (light bits) are soaked up by the semiconducting materials within the panels, typically constructed from silicon. This absorption creates an electrical present as the photons knock electrons loosened from the atoms within the product.

The electrical areas within the solar cells after that compel these electrons to stream in a specific direction, developing a straight current (DC) of electricity. This direct current is then passed through an inverter, which transforms it right into alternating existing (AC) electrical energy that can be utilized to power your home or company.

Excess electrical energy created by the photovoltaic panels can be stored in batteries for later use or fed back right into the grid for credit report with a process called net metering. Recognizing Photovoltaic Panel Elements



One critical element of photovoltaic panel modern technology is recognizing the various elements that compose a photovoltaic panel system.

The key components of a photovoltaic panel system consist of the photovoltaic panels themselves, which are made up of photovoltaic cells that convert sunlight right into power. These panels are placed on a structure, usually a roofing system, to record sunshine.

Along with the panels, there are inverters that transform the straight present (DC) electricity created by the panels into alternating current (AIR CONDITIONER) electricity that can be used in homes or organizations.

The system also includes racking to sustain and place the photovoltaic panels for optimum sunshine exposure.
